|
madwifi i zawieszanie się systemu
arcktick - 01-10-2009 00:17
Jajko 2.6.24.7, WiFi na chipsecie Atheros, skompilowane madwifi.
Część dotycząca ath0 w pliku /etc/network/interfaces:
ath0 iface ath0 inet static pre-up wlanconfig ath0 destroy pre-up wlanconfig ath0 create wlandev wifi0 wlanmode ap up /sbin/ifconfig ath0 up down /sbin/ifconfig ath0 down address 192.168.2.253 netmask 255.255.255.0
Przy poleceniu ustawiającym kanał, na którym ma punkt dostępowy nadawać:
iwconfig ath0 channel 11
Próbowałem też dla wartości 6, oczywiście dzieje się to samo.
System całkowicie się zawiesza. W logach nie ma żadnego śladu.
A i jeszcze tutaj ifconfig ath0:
ath0 Link encap:Ethernet HWaddr 00:11:95:DC:16:EB inet addr:192.168.2.253 Bcast:192.168.2.255 Mask:255.255.255.0 U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1 RX packets:0 errors:0 dropped:0 overruns:0 frame:0 TX packets:70 errors:0 dropped:0 overruns:0 carrier:0 collisions:0 txqueuelen:0 RX bytes:0 (0.0 b) TX bytes:10857 (10.6 KiB)
iwconfig:
ath0 IEEE 802.11g ESSID:"Parkowa" Nickname:"" Mode:Master Frequency:2.412 GHz Access Point: 00:11:95:DC:16:EB Bit Rate:0 kb/s Tx-Power:18 dBm Sensitivity=1/1 Retry:off RTS thr:off Fragment thr:off Encryption key:off Power Management:off Link Quality=0/70 Signal level=-96 dBm Noise level=-96 dBm Rx invalid nwid:67 Rx invalid crypt:0 Rx invalid frag:0 Tx excessive retries:0 Invalid misc:0 Missed beacon:0
Ktoś ma może pomysł co jest grane? Pozdrawiam i dziękuję za wszelkie podpowiedzi.
M3cin - 02-10-2009 16:48
Nie jestem specem ale też mam kartę madwifi w Samsungu NC10 i musiałem kompilować nowe jądro ponieważ właśnie sterowniki źle działały. Wiem, że musiałem dopisać do czarnej listy sterowniki ath i wgrać jakieś inne. U mnie karta bezprzewodowa identyfikuje się z wlan0.
Poczytaj to, może pomoże, u mnie pomogło: http://eko.one.pl/index.php?page=samsungnc10#wifi
arcktick - 02-10-2009 21:13
Mógłbyś jeszcze napisać z jakich repzytoriów korzystałeś ściągając ten pakiet? Dzięki
M3cin - 02-10-2009 22:14
Tam masz opisane wszystko ale to pod samsunga NC10, a u Ciebie nie wiem czy zadziała, na samej górze masz:
deb http://ppa.launchpad.net/voria/ppa/ubuntu jaunty main
To jest co prawda z Ubuntu, ale deb, lecz może wystarczy tylko jądro >= 2.6.28-15-generic zainstalować? Wrzuć w Google pytanie i poczytaj, może są jakieś inne sposoby? Pozdrawiam.
pavbaranov - 03-10-2009 09:03
M3cin, wprowadzasz zamęt. arcktick, pyta o madwifi na kernelu z serii 2.6.24, Ty zaś proponujesz rozwiązanie ze sterownikiem ath5k (Twój NC10 na nim właśnie pracuje), nadto na nowszym kernelu i w dodatku z innego systemu, w którym - akurat - instalacja sterowników tego typu jak ath5k odbywa się inaczej niż w Debianie. Dodatkowo podajesz jeszcze repozytorium z paczkami kompilowanymi pod NC10. Paczka deb nie ma tu żadnego znaczenia. Rozwiązanie, które proponujesz jest prostą drogą do padnięcia nie tylko madwifi, ale całego systemu.
arcktick, czy madwifi w trybie odbiorczym (managed, ad-hoc) działa prawidłowo? Może skorzystaj z przygotowanych paczek deb z madwifi i instaluj przez module-assistanta, a nie kompiluj własnorczęcznie (niekiedy takie rozwiązanie daje dobre efekty) I z czystej ciekawości. Masz tak:
up /sbin/ifconfig ath0 up down /sbin/ifconfig ath0 down
Po jakiego grzyba najpierw podnosisz interfejs ath0, po to, by za chwilę go wyłączyć?
zanotowane.pldoc.pisz.plpdf.pisz.plminister.pev.pl
|